What it actually is, in plain English.

Most agencies and most one-person studios are run as roadmaps. Pick a thing, ship it, move on. The Workloft Loop is the opposite. Every piece of work is a single cycle of one continuous engine. The engine has three stages, and they feed each other.

01

Research

The lab reads the field every weekday morning. Papers, releases, regulator updates, customer signals. The interesting bits become Workloft Labs, a daily public digest. Internally it sets the backlog of what to build next.

02

Ship

We build the smallest thing that proves an idea. Sovereign by default, signed, audit-logged. Every ship is announced in plain English on the Ships log, with what changed and why it matters. If a build can be open-sourced, it is.

03

Publish

Code goes to github.com/workloftai/ships. Articles go on the homepage. Posts go to LinkedIn and X. None of this is marketing spend. It is the third stage of the engine: every public artefact surfaces new feedback, which seeds the next cycle of research.


Why a loop, not a roadmap.

A roadmap assumes the world holds still. The world does not hold still, so a roadmap is a wish list. A loop assumes the work changes the problem. You ship, the field reacts, your next research cycle accounts for the reaction, your next ship is sharper than the last. The Loop is what happens when you treat your own outputs as inputs.

Practically, that means the Workloft homepage you are reading this on is itself part of the Loop. So is the Ships log. So are the agents sitting on the VPS. So is this article. The whole thing is one engine running in public.
